CVE-2026-52806
CRITICAL · CVSS 9.9
EPSS exploitation probability: 0%
Published 2026-06-24T21:16:56.440 · Last modified 2026-06-24T21:16:56.440

Summary

Gogs is an open source self-hosted Git service. Prior to 0.14.3, Gogs allows authenticated users to achieve Remote Code Execution (RCE) on the server by creating a pull request with a specially crafted branch name that injects the --exec flag into the git rebase command during the "Rebase before merging" merge operation. This vulnerability is fixed in 0.14.3.
